Posted on December 15, 2015 at 12:25 am

Events Featured What's Happenin'

#12DaysOfChristmas Day 2 – Grandma’s red sweater

Every year, Christian children around India wait for one thing – Grandma’s Christmas visit. Ironically, that is the one visit they also dread the most. While Grandma is keen on bringing homemade goodies, lots of money and presents, there is one thing you wish that Grandma would forget to pack – the red sweater.
No matter how busy Grandma may be, she always manages to find a set of horrid red sweaters with snowmen, Christmas trees and all kinds of fuzzy warm décor for the whole family. What’s worst, you are obligated to put on that blood red sweater and parade it around the house for Christmas dinner. If you don’t, you are subject to Grandma’s famous “this could be my last Christmas” speech.
At the end of the day, we all love Grandma and are willing to put on that hideous red sweater to see a smile on her face.